If you wish to, you can change the default Keychain on the Mac. But you aren’t limited to using only that keychain, or having that as your default keychain. If you aren’t familiar with Keychain, it is a password management tool developed by Apple that’s seamlessly integrated into macOS, iPadOS, and iOS devices, allowing you to securely store your login information so that you don’t have to remember all your logins and passwords. By default on the Mac, your Mac creates a keychain called “login”, and its password is the same as the user password that you use to log in to your Mac.
